Matildas through to World Cup quarters

20/09/2007 09:23:03 PM Comments (0)

Australia is through to the quarter-finals of the Women's Soccer World Cup in China after a dramatic 2-all draw with Canada in their final group game.

Captain and veteran defender Cheryl Salisbury scored a stoppage time goal to secure the point the Matildas needed to finish second in the group.

Australia will probably play either Brazil or China in their quarter-final on Sunday.

The Matildas fell behind to a first minute goal in Chengdu, before Collette McCallum equalised, but trailed a second time before Salisbury's late equaliser.
